Three Signs That Indicate You Need Residential Dryer Vent Cleaning Services

Similarly to your washing machine, it is also essential to conduct regular maintenance services on your dryer as well. Unfortunately, most people only clean out the dryer's lint trap and forget about the dryer vent. The dryer vent is responsible for pushing out the warm and moist air produced in the dryer to ensure your clothes dry quickly. However, after some time, the dryer vent is susceptible to accumulating dust and lint. Read More 

Top 4 Indicators You Should Consider Replacing Your HVAC Ductwork

Your heating and air conditioner ductwork is a network of connections responsible for delivering chilled and heated air to the rooms around your home. If their installation was not made by a professional, they could cause a spike in your energy bills and cause comfort issues. Also, AC ducts have a lifespan of 20 years, and if they are past their end of life, you're likely to have duct issues.
